Has anyone camped at the Fort Wilderness campsite during marathon weekend? If so, do they provide bus to the starting line?

Thanks!
 
I don't know for certain, but it would seem that they have something. They advertise that the bus pick up is from all on property resorts. Only thing I am thinking is that it will not go through the camp area to pick up. Probably have to meet at the "front" (Lodge) then? That might probably mean a hike before a race though.
 
We stayed at Ft. Wilderness for the 2007 marathon weekend and there was transportation from the campground to the race. We didn't use it but saw the sign near the area were you check in if you are staying in a cabin. Hope this was helpful.
 
Yes, there is transport. The Disney drivers will pick up inside the campground, just like the regular campground transportation. They stop at each bus stop in the CG. Then they take you to the Wilderness Lodge where you meet up with the big bus that will take you to the start line.

It sounds inefficient, but it works really well. Our Disney driver told us that they do it this way because they tried letting the contract companies drive through the campground, but they kept getting lost or stuck in the tight spots the Disney drivers know to avoid. So it was easier to let the regular drivers do the CG and have them meet up with the contracted transportation elsewhere.
 

I've stayed at FW for the 2006 and 2007 Marathons and have reservations for 2008. I've used the buses every time.

The buses run from the Outpost to the Settlement Depot and pick up at all stops along the "outer" campground side and then head for the WL where you transfer to tour buses. I'm not sure if the same goes for the "inner" campground loop or for the cabins.

Getting back is the reverse.
